Getting Started: Connection and Pairing
To begin using the Amazfit GTS 3, users must download and install the Zepp app on their smartphone. The watch pairs with the phone via Bluetooth, requiring a minimum of Android 7.0 or iOS 12.0. The manual details the initial pairing process using a QR code displayed on the watch screen and provides instructions for pairing with a new phone, including unpairing the old device and restoring factory settings if necessary.
Basic Operations and Navigation
The manual outlines common gestures and button functions for navigating the watch interface. This includes tapping the screen to select items, pressing and holding the watch face for customization, covering the screen to turn it off, swiping for page navigation, and using the digital crown. The side button is described for powering on, restarting, and accessing specific functions.
Key Features and Functionality
- Control Center: Quick access to system features like flashlight, DND, Wi-Fi, and settings.
- Find Phone/Watch: Features to locate paired devices.
- Watch Faces: Customization options including compilations, adding online faces, and changing existing ones.
- Notifications and Calls: Receiving app alerts and incoming call notifications from a connected smartphone.
- Shortcuts and Widgets: Customizable cards and widgets for quick access to frequently used apps and information.
- Workouts: Support for over 150 workout modes, detailed tracking, workout history, and performance indicators like VO2max and Training Effect.
- Health Monitoring: Comprehensive tracking of heart rate, blood oxygen, stress levels, sleep quality, and activity metrics.
- Voice Assistant: Offline voice control and integration with Amazon Alexa for hands-free operation.
- Watch Apps: Built-in applications for music control, alarms, calendar, weather, timers, and more.
